These bars mainly consist of commercially pure titanium (Grades 1–4) or titanium alloys like Grade 5 (Ti-6Al-4V), which incorporates aluminum and vanadium to boost strength and heat resistance. They showcase remarkable corrosion resistance against seawater, chemicals, and acidic environments, along with impressive tensile strength, toughness, and fatigue resistance. Thanks to titanium’s low density and exceptional mechanical properties, these bars maintain their shape and structural integrity even under extreme temperatures and heavy loads, making them perfect for critical engineering and industrial tasks.

Titanium Bars find extensive use in aerospace, marine, chemical processing, medical, and automotive sectors. In aerospace, they’re employed for structural components, landing gear, and airframe parts due to their excellent strength-to-weight ratio. In the chemical and marine industries, they act as shafts, fasteners, and structural supports that endure aggressive environments. In the medical field, they’re used for surgical instruments, implants, and prosthetic devices, where biocompatibility and corrosion resistance are vital. Plus, Titanium Bars are also utilized in industrial machinery, power generation, and oil and gas equipment, ensuring reliable performance and longevity even under demanding conditions.
